Milwaukee Sausage n' Kraut Supper

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 pounds low-fat turkey kielbasa, cut into 3 inch pieces
  • 3 (10 ounce) cans Bavarian-style sauerkraut, rinsed and drained
  • 3 large Granny Smith apples, cored, peeled and cut crosswise into rings
  • 1 medium onion, thinly sliced and separated into rings
  • 1 (14 ounce) can fat free chicken broth
  • 1/2 teaspoon caraway seeds
  • 8 medium size red potatoes (about 3 1/2 pounds) peeled and quartered
  • 3/4 cup water
  • Garnish: Chopped parsley

Details

Servings 8
Preparation time 20mins
Cooking time 24mins

Preparation

Step 1

Place half of sausage in a 6 quart slow cooker, top with sauerkraut, remaining sausage, apple slices and onion rings. Pour broth over mixture, and sprinkle with caraway seeds.

Cover and cook on high 4 hours or until apples and onion are tender.

Meanwhile, place potatoes in a large microwave safe bowl with 3/4 cup water. Cover loosely with heavy duty plastic wrap and microwave at high 10 minutes. Stir, cover and microwave 5 more minutes. Drain.

Arrange sausage mixture and potatoes on individual plates. Garnish with parsley, if desired. Makes 8 servings.

Serving size, 1 1/2 cups sausage mixture and 1 cup potatoes.
